Compare commits
2 Commits
3c16d2c5ec
...
a49f2b462f
Author | SHA1 | Date | |
---|---|---|---|
a49f2b462f | |||
833503f455 |
28
.gitea/workflows/docker.yml
Normal file
28
.gitea/workflows/docker.yml
Normal file
@ -0,0 +1,28 @@
|
|||||||
|
name: Build docker image
|
||||||
|
|
||||||
|
on:
|
||||||
|
push:
|
||||||
|
branches: ["main"]
|
||||||
|
|
||||||
|
env:
|
||||||
|
REGISTRY: git.matterlinux.xyz
|
||||||
|
IMAGE: ${{gitea.repository}}
|
||||||
|
|
||||||
|
jobs:
|
||||||
|
build:
|
||||||
|
runs-on: ubuntu-latest
|
||||||
|
steps:
|
||||||
|
- name: Checkout repository
|
||||||
|
uses: "https://github.com/actions/checkout@v4"
|
||||||
|
|
||||||
|
- name: Login to container repo
|
||||||
|
uses: "https://github.com/docker/login-action@v1"
|
||||||
|
with:
|
||||||
|
registry: ${{env.REGISTRY}}
|
||||||
|
username: ${{gitea.actor}}
|
||||||
|
password: ${{secrets.PACKAGES_TOKEN}}
|
||||||
|
|
||||||
|
- name: Build image
|
||||||
|
run: |
|
||||||
|
docker build --tag ${{env.REGISTRY}}/${{env.IMAGE}}:latest .
|
||||||
|
docker push ${{env.REGISTRY}}/${{env.IMAGE}}:latest
|
@ -1,4 +1,7 @@
|
|||||||
# libmp | MatterLinux package management library
|
# libmp | MatterLinux package management library
|
||||||
|
|
||||||
|

|
||||||
|
|
||||||
The core library for [`matt`](https://git.matterlinux.xyz/Matter/matt), it has
|
The core library for [`matt`](https://git.matterlinux.xyz/Matter/matt), it has
|
||||||
components for transferring, installing, updating and removing packages.
|
components for transferring, installing, updating and removing packages.
|
||||||
|
|
||||||
|
@ -19,7 +19,12 @@ int main(int argc, char *argv[]) {
|
|||||||
goto end;
|
goto end;
|
||||||
}
|
}
|
||||||
|
|
||||||
if (lm_ctx_pool_add(&ctx, "test", "mptp://127.0.0.1:5858", "./examples/test") == NULL) {
|
if (lm_ctx_pool_add(&ctx, "test", "mptp://s.test.local", "./examples/test") == NULL) {
|
||||||
|
printf("failed to add pool: %s (%d)\n", lm_strerror(), lm_error());
|
||||||
|
goto end;
|
||||||
|
}
|
||||||
|
|
||||||
|
if (lm_ctx_pool_add(&ctx, "test", "mptp://n.test.local", "/tmp/test") == NULL) {
|
||||||
printf("failed to add pool: %s (%d)\n", lm_strerror(), lm_error());
|
printf("failed to add pool: %s (%d)\n", lm_strerror(), lm_error());
|
||||||
goto end;
|
goto end;
|
||||||
}
|
}
|
||||||
|
Loading…
x
Reference in New Issue
Block a user